Torghelle earns call-up

New Palace striker Sandor Torghelle has been called up to the latest Hungary squad.

The 22-year-old has been selected for the trip to Scotland in a friendly on Wednesday, August 18.

Torghelle was signed by Palace from MTK Hungaria earlier this month for £750,000 and if selected for his country, will win his eighth international cap.

His countryman and goalkeeper Gabor Kiraly is set to join him in South London with Palace once he completes a medical.

"I've made the most important decision of my life, that's why I was so patient," Kiraly told skysports.com.

"Crystal Palace is a young team, hungry for success and the coaches expect us to avoid relegation.

"To do this we need superb team play and we will have to do our best."
